タグ

2015年12月1日のブックマーク (4件)

  • Go言語に継承は無いんですか【golang】 - DRYな備忘録

    困った 継承が無いのは困った。共通メソッドとかどうすりゃええねん的な。 前回のダックタイピングって一体なんなのよ【golang】 - DRYな備忘録に引き続き、めっちゃ参考にしたのはこれ Go言語における埋め込みによるインタフェースの部分実装パターン - Qiita みんなのGo言語【現場で使える実践テクニック】 作者: 松木雅幸,mattn,藤原俊一郎,中島大一,牧大輔,鈴木健太,稲葉貴洋出版社/メーカー: 技術評論社発売日: 2016/09/09メディア: 大型この商品を含むブログ (3件) を見る 埋め込み(embed)っていうのがあるのだ golangはstructの定義にstructの定義を「埋め込む(embed)」ことができる。それはプロパティを持たせるのとは違う。(継承に近い、が、ダックタイピングと合い重なって色々できそうな予感ある) package main import

    Go言語に継承は無いんですか【golang】 - DRYな備忘録
  • dbr – Go 言語 O/R Mapper の紹介

    Go その2 Advent Calendar 2015 – Qiita 1日目のエントリ第一弾です。(第二弾: Echo – Go 言語 Web Framework の紹介) 当社では現在プロダクトの開発に Go言語 を利用しています。開発の中で得られた知見を徐々に公開していきます。 Go 言語で利用されるデータベース関連パッケージでは、O/R Mapper に位置づけられる gorm や gorp、 QueryBuilder の squirrel が広く知られています。 今回のエントリでは、おすすめの O/R Mapper dbr を紹介します。 gocraft/dbr – Github dbr は、現在 Star の数では gorm や gorp に比べ少ないですが、2015年9月に更新された V2.0 で機能が大幅に強化され、これから人気が高まるのではないかと予想しています。 dbr

    dbr – Go 言語 O/R Mapper の紹介
  • GoのGUIライブラリshinyを試す #golang - Qiita

    はじめに この記事は、2015年のGo Advent Calendarの1日目の記事です。 GoのAdvent Calendarは他にも2つあり、他の日担当の方は以下のとおりです。 Go その2:iktakahiroさんのdbr – Go 言語 O/R Mapper の紹介 Go その3:awakiaさんのGoのChannelを使いこなせるようになるための手引 この記事は2015年12月1日時点の情報を基に書いています。また、情報が少ない中、shinyのプロポーザルとソースコードを基に筆者なりに解釈した結果を書いていますので、間違いや勘違いを含んでいるかもしれません。間違いや勘違いを見つけた方は、ぜひコメントか編集リクエストを頂ければと思います。 なお、使用しているリビジョンは48f611b013d6f6fbecb58f8212b1152abb23b928です。 shinyはまだ始まった

    GoのGUIライブラリshinyを試す #golang - Qiita
  • 超優秀なプレイヤーは出世させてはいけない

    Recent Commentsクラウドソーシングでパキスタン人にアニメーションを作らせてみた | innova on アニメをアウトソースする#031 金持ち父さん貧乏父さん 実践その1:まず5つの障害を乗り越えよう (#3 怠け心) | あすなろ(earth76)式 on プレゼンの冒頭で伝えなければいけないWIIFMとは?何故日人はブレストを嫌うのか | Masafumi Otsuka's Blog on 根回しが何故日人に必要なのか、ちゃんと説明しよう外国人上司に「私に活躍させたかったらやり方をこう変えて欲しい」と言葉にして伝えよ う! | Masafumi Otsuka's Blog on 根回しが何故日人に必要なのか、ちゃんと説明しよう外国人上司に「私に活躍させたかったらやり方をこう変えて欲しい」と言葉にして伝えよ う! | Masafumi Otsuka's Blog o

    超優秀なプレイヤーは出世させてはいけない